How Your Child’s Temperament Shapes Their Development

From the very beginning, babies differ in temperament – and these differences influence how we interact with them and shape their experience of the world. In this session, BabyLab researchers (Dr Antonia Goetz and Sheena Stow-Smith) explore: What temperament is and how it shapes parent-child interaction Extroverted vs introverted personalities – what differences in language learning can we see? How can we adapt our interaction to support different children? Understanding temperament helps us move from comparison to connection – and from frustration to responsiveness.

What Babies and Young Children Know (& How We Know It!)

Babies understand far more than we often realise – long before they can speak. In this session, Professor Susan Hespos explores the science of early learning and reveals how researchers uncover what children know about the world.

BabyLab Podcast Season 1

Hosted by Jamila Rizvi, the eight-part series discusses ground-breaking research from Western Sydney University experts in psychology, linguistics, speech and language, and explores topics such as baby talk, bilingualism, learning to read, first words and play.
